Output fbfb30237f8af05c72bc11e81752aebfe2f942dfc3613265511ecc966806737f:1

value
18500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ae4a29a21a9c4f1e912dd394d0df02ec92ecbb3 OP_EQUAL
address
3Fp1swCnoUnMnt6Hm1A9XgGhZbRegs8t2E
transaction
fbfb30237f8af05c72bc11e81752aebfe2f942dfc3613265511ecc966806737f
spent
true